Using their inflatable microphones, which had been supplied to attendees, a disc jockey encourages visitors on the dance flooring to hitch in on the refrain of Backstreet Boys’ “I Want It That Way” throughout the Sing-Along Brunch on Saturday at Sunrise Inn. The inaugural women-only occasion was cohosted by The Small District, which opened in October at 523 E. Market St. in Warren. It options 17 girls owned companies in a single location.

WARREN — Offering a nod to Cyndi Lauper’s 1983 worldwide hit single and subsequent feminist anthem, “Girls Just Want To Have Fun,” the ladies who attended the debut of the Sing-Along Brunch celebrated a break from their busy lives and let unfastened for a number of hours Saturday at Sunrise Inn.

“I’ve seen them on Facebook, and they always look so fun. So, I couldn’t wait for one to come to Trumbull County,” stated Sarah Kennedy of Bristolville, who was amongst these on the packed dancefloor and took half within the Sing-Along Battle.

Hosted by The Small District and the restaurant, the sold-out affair featured 100 girls revelers having fun with a breakfast buffet from Sunrise Inn together with quite a few grownup drinks, together with mimosas and a wide range of laborious seltzers.

A disc jockey performed a nonstop, beat-heavy set that appeared that it was halfway by a high-energy marriage ceremony reception. It included hits by Lauper, Pink, Katy Perry, Gwen Stefani, Usher, Natasha Bedingfield, Neil Diamond, Backstreet Boys, New Kids on the Block, Vanilla Ice and extra.

During Ludacris’ “What’s Your Fantasy” the partygoers instantly broke right into a line dance. Set to tunes by Shaggy and Spice Girls, the Sing-Along (lip-sync) Battle induced a short break from the dancing. Later, an unscheduled empty can-stacking competitors happened between two tables.

While the sort of “safe space” occasion has develop into standard nationwide, Small District founder Angel Williams defined the origins of the native version.

“I first saw a sing-along brunch on TikTok from a restaurant down in southern Ohio and thought, ‘Why not bring it to Warren?’ I’m always looking to have a good time in Warren, and I know how to throw a party. I’ve thrown events at The Small District and they’ve been a huge success. So, I thought, ‘Why not give this a try?’”

Asked why brunch as an alternative of getting the sing-along later within the day, Williams replied, “I want to be in bed by 8. I am a mom and a business owner, and I’m tired. I figured I would rather day drink than drink late at night so I could be home in time for dinner.”

Williams described The Small District, which opened in October at 523 E. Market St. in Warren, as “a small enterprise mall per se. We have 17 girls owned companies in a single location, constructing one another up, encouraging one another.

Her outlet, Stanley Grace Boutique, which is positioned there, does hair styling in addition to eyelashes plus there are kiosks that carry every little thing from present baskets to jewellery.

“We say, ‘It’s the ultimate girls day.’”

Like lots of the attendees, Kennedy came upon concerning the singalong by Facebook and The Small District.

“I feel excitement and empowerment for women. I feel like everyone’s having a great time. We’re not judging each other. We’re not shooting dog eyes to each other. We’re just having a fun time altogether with a bunch of chicks. It’s great,” stated Kennedy, who attended with three pals.

She added, “It’s important to bring positive publicity to the city. I really hope that this is a good change for Warren and that things like this can bring good business, good people and good energy to the city.”

Sunrise Inn supervisor Bobby Miller stated, “Angel is across the street from us and partnered with us. We’re glad to help them get off the ground.”

“Kudos to Angel for setting it all up and to everybody that showed up,” stated Thomas Adair, Sunrise Inn basic supervisor. “It was a packed house, and it went really well. So, we will do this as long as everybody wants to keep showing up.”

Since the primary sing-along reached capability weeks prematurely, Williams acknowledges that there’s an curiosity within the space.

“I will definitely be having more, probably one in June, one in August. Do one every few months just to give the ladies of Warren something to look forward to.”
